Output 629fb35a3cfd25f07405ef903da147e77e3d204fc709a1cfd3d7a82d2f13dbdd:2

value
65000
script pubkey
OP_0 OP_PUSHBYTES_20 f338437f708701365b2264b31e1de8a4d243610e
address
tb1q7vuyxlmssuqnvkezvje3u80g5nfyxcgw3pejqh
transaction
629fb35a3cfd25f07405ef903da147e77e3d204fc709a1cfd3d7a82d2f13dbdd
confirmations
18050
spent
true